Low-overhead tracing of all Linux kernel-user transitions, for serious performance analysis. Includes kernel patches, loadable module, and post-processing software. Output is HTML/SVG per-CPU-core timeline that you can pan/zoom down to the nanosecond.
LiME (formerly DMD) is a Loadable Kernel Module (LKM), which allows the acquisition of volatile memory from Linux and Linux-based devices, such as those powered by Android.
